pra-lima87 wrote:

Is just like most of the console shortcomings, "oh the console can't handle cast on movement".


No one ever said that either. (at least, not anyone from GGG)

They don't currently plan to implement cast on move on console. There are likely several reasons for that. Performance isn't one of them, AFAIK.

The control systems for console work very differently. PC players click a button to move. They are also allowed to bind a skill to that button. We do not click anything to move. Therefore we can't bind a skill to it. There is no button to bind to.

It would be significant work to implement an equivalent system on console, and they have chosen to invest their hours elsewhere.

Nders66 wrote:

iam no hardware wiz but the ram argument i think it is bullshit.


Have you read any of the extensive older threads on the topic? Do you know how Betrayal missions work (technologically) on PC? Because of the way Betrayal works on PC, it literally has to load every single Betrayal asset into memory for any map that has Betrayal. That's every member's voice lines, graphics, etc. It's quite a lot of data. In addition to all the data the game already needs just to let you play a map.

Both the PS4 and PS4 Pro have 8GB of unified memory. This means that the main system RAM and the GPU memory are shared. So, if you're using 2GB of RAM for the GPU, the main system only has 6GB left for the entire OS and everything the game is doing. If you need 4GB for the GPU, then the main system only has 4GB for the entire OS and everything the game is doing.

It's quite limiting.
